The 2001 Subaru Forester useS4.2 quarts of SAE 5W-30 oil. Subaru recommends that You use synthetic oil whenever You need to change it in Your car. The two main types of oil that You will encounter these days are synthetic and conventional. Synthetic is a newer type of oil that is engineered in a lab to give You greater wear protection and longer life than the petroleum-based conventional option. This means Your engine stays protected for longer and You need less frequent oil changes as well which can save money in the long run. You should check Your oil at least once a month to make sure that it is full and free from any debris or signs of burning.

The 2001 Subaru Forester's 2.5L box-4 engine uses 4.2 quarts of 5W30 (preferred) 10W30 or 10W40 (above -4 F) 30 weight, 40 weight, 20W40, or 20W50 (above 95 F or heavy duty operation).
